Southwest Chicken Wrap Recipe

This Southwest Chicken Wrap is a flavorful and healthy lunch option featuring tender cooked chicken breast mixed with black beans, corn, and zesty spices, all wrapped in a soft flour tortilla with fresh lettuce and optional toppings like avocado and jalapeños. Ready in just 15 minutes, it offers a satisfying balance of protein, fiber, and bold southwestern flavors perfect for a quick meal.


Ingredients

Scale

Filling

  • 2 cups cooked chicken breast, shredded or chopped
  • 1/2 cup canned black beans, rinsed and drained
  • 1/2 cup corn kernels (fresh, canned, or frozen and thawed)
  • 1/2 cup diced red bell pepper
  • 1/4 cup chopped red onion
  • 1/2 cup shredded cheddar or Monterey Jack cheese
  • 1/4 cup sour cream or Greek yogurt
  • 2 tablespoons salsa
  • 1 teaspoon chili pow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cumin
  • Salt and black pepper to taste

Wrap

  • 4 large flour tortillas
  • 1 cup shredded lettuce or chopped romaine

Optional Toppings

  • Avocado slices
  • Jalapeños
  • Cilantro
  • Lime wedges


Instructions

  1. Prepare the Filling: In a large bowl, combine the cooked chicken, black beans, corn, diced red bell pepper, chopped red onion, shredded cheese, sour cream, salsa, chili powder, ground cumin, salt, and black pepper. Stir well until all ingredients are evenly coated and mixed thoroughly.
  2. Warm the Tortillas: Slightly warm the flour tortillas either in the microwave for 15-20 seconds or on a skillet over medium heat for about 30 seconds per side. Warming makes the tortillas more pliable and easier to roll without tearing.
  3. Assemble the Wraps: Lay each warm tortilla flat. Spread a layer of shredded lettuce on each, then spoon the chicken mixture evenly down the center of each tortilla.
  4. Add Optional Toppings: Add avocado slices, jalapeños, cilantro, or a squeeze of lime juice on top of the filling if using, to add extra flavor and freshness.
  5. Roll the Wraps: Fold in the sides of each tortilla and then roll tightly from the bottom up to enclose the filling. Slice the wraps in half diagonally for easier eating and presentation.
  6. Serve: Serve the wraps immediately or wrap them tightly in foil or parchment for later consumption.

Notes

  • You can prepare the wraps ahead of time and store them wrapped in foil or parchment paper in the refrigerator for up to 2 days.
  • For a low-carb alternative, substitute the flour tortillas with large lettuce leaves or low-carb tortillas.
  • Using grilled chicken breast adds extra smoky flavor to the filling if you have time to cook it fresh.
